Milk Options and Selections
Milk serves as the foundation for homemade yogurt, playing a crucial role in determining the final texture and flavor. Different varieties of milk can be utilized, including whole, skim, and low-fat options. Whole milk typically produces a creamier, richer yogurt, while skim milk results in a lighter consistency. For those seeking alternative options, plant-based milks, such as almond, soy, or coconut, can be utilized, though they may require additional thickeners to achieve the desired texture. It is essential to evaluate the nutritional content and flavor profile of each milk type, as they can influence the fermentation process. Finally, the choice of milk should align with personal preferences and dietary needs, ensuring a satisfying homemade yogurt experience.
Starter Culture Selection
The success of homemade yogurt hinges significantly on the selection of an appropriate starter culture, which introduces beneficial bacteria critical for fermentation. Commonly, commercial yogurt containing live active cultures serves as an excellent choice for beginners. Look for strains such as Lactobacillus bulgaricus and Streptococcus thermophilus, which are crucial for thickening and flavor development. Moreover, some may prefer specific probiotic blends, offering diverse health benefits. When selecting a starter culture, one should verify freshness, as older cultures may have decreased viability. For those seeking more control over the fermentation process, purchasing freeze-dried starter cultures can be beneficial. Ultimately, the chosen culture will influence the yogurt's texture, taste, and probiotic content, making its selection a significant step in the yogurt-making journey.

Step-by-Step Guide to Making Yogurt
Preparing yogurt at home can be a fulfilling experience that allows for customization and control over ingredients. The process starts by gathering the necessary supplies: milk, a yogurt starter containing live cultures, and a yogurt maker. First, the milk should be heated to around 180°F to remove any unwanted bacteria, then cooled to around 110°F. Once cooled, a small amount of yogurt starter is mixed into the milk, ensuring it is thoroughly mixed. This mixture is then poured into the yogurt maker and set to ferment for a advised period, typically between 6 to 12 hours, depending on wanted thickness and tartness. After fermentation, the yogurt is refrigerated to stop the process. Finally, it can be enjoyed plain, or flavored with fruits, sweeteners, or spices, fulfilling personal preferences. With practice, this homemade yogurt can become a wonderful staple in any diet.
Guidelines for Attaining Flawless Fermentation
Attaining perfect fermentation is vital for creating find guide creamy, flavorful yogurt, and multiple key factors can significantly influence the outcome. First, maintaining an perfect temperature is critical; most yogurts require a consistent environment between 110°F to 115°F. This temperature encourages the growth of beneficial bacteria while suppressing harmful pathogens. Second, selecting premium starter cultures assures that the desired probiotics thrive during fermentation. New, live cultures will generate better results compared to older or inactive ones.
Furthermore, the duration of fermentation plays a significant role; longer fermentation periods can intensify the tanginess and thickness, while shorter durations produce a milder flavor. It is also crucial to use fresh milk, as the quality immediately influences the yogurt's texture and taste. Ultimately, avoiding disturbances during the fermentation process assists in maintain a consistent environment, allowing the bacteria to work effectively without interruption. Following these tips can result in a successful yogurt-making experience.

Keeping and Utilizing Your House-Made Yogurt
Once the yogurt has been prepared successfully, proper storage is essential to keep its freshness and probiotic qualities. Homemade yogurt should be transferred to clean, airtight containers to stop contamination and spoilage. Glass jars or plastic containers with tight-fitting lids are excellent for this purpose.
It's recommended to refrigerate the yogurt immediately after making it to slow down bacterial activity and maintain both flavor and texture. With proper storage, homemade yogurt can last for up to two weeks.
In terms of usage, yogurt can be consumed plain or used as a base for salad dressings, smoothies, or desserts. Including granola, honey, or fruits can increase its nutritional value and taste. Moreover, yogurt can be frozen for prolonged storage, though this may change its texture when thawed. By following these storage and usage tips, one can thoroughly enjoy the benefits of homemade probiotic yogurt.

Is Non-Dairy Milk Suitable for Yogurt Making?
Yes, non-dairy milk can be used for yogurt making. Though, it might need specialized cultures and tweaks to attain the desired texture and taste, since the fermentation method varies from conventional dairy yogurt.
How Long Can Yogurt Be Stored in the Fridge?
Yogurt usually remains fresh for between one and three weeks under refrigeration if stored correctly. Spoilage indicators include unpleasant odors, changes in texture, or mold development; therefore, routine checks are suggested for ensuring quality and safety.
Can I Use Yogurt Starter Again After Fermentation?
Reusing yogurt starter after fermentation is certainly feasible. However, the potency may reduce after multiple uses. For maintaining optimal performance, restrict repeated uses and intermittently refresh with new starter cultures.
What Happens When Fermentation Temperature Drops Too Low?
When fermentation temperature is lower than optimal, the yogurt cultures may become inactive, resulting in incomplete fermentation. This can lead to a less thick texture, absence of tanginess, and diminished probiotic benefits, finally compromising the overall yogurt quality.
Is Eating Expired Yogurt Safe?
Yogurt past its expiration date might still be safe for consumption if it displays no signs of spoilage, such as unpleasant odors or mold. However, its quality and probiotic benefits may diminish considerably after the expiration date.
